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Place the pie crust in a 9-inch pie dish and set aside.
  3. In a small sa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Continue cooking, stirring frequently, until the butter turns golden brown and has a nutty aroma.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
  4. In a medium bowl, whisk together the eggs, granulated sugar, light corn syrup, vanilla extract, and salt.
  5. Slowly pour the browned butter into the egg mixture, whisking constantly.
  6. Stir in the pecans.
  7. Pour the filling into the prepared pie crust.
  8. Bake for 45-50 minutes, or until the filling is set and the crust is golden brown.
  9. Remove from the oven and let cool for at least 2 hours before serving.
